halloween

(10/29/01)


_________First Place__________


halloween
a few night crawlers
on the sidewalk

Darrell Byrd

  

 ________Second Place________ halloween night Superman falls asleep in my arms ~naia



 _________Third Place________ halloween - the smallest ghost has rosy cheeks Laurene full moon - two little witches battle for the last snickers Kathy Lippard Cobb halloween a witch removes her nose to sneeze Hugh Waterhouse
